import { type RefObject, useEffect, useRef } from "react"
|
|
import { useTranslation } from "react-i18next"
|
|
|
|
import { AnsiLogLine } from "@/components/logs/ansi-log-line"
|
|
import { ScrollArea } from "@/components/ui/scroll-area"
|
|
|
|
const AUTO_SCROLL_THRESHOLD_PX = 24
|
|
|
|
function isNearBottom(viewport: HTMLDivElement) {
|
|
const distanceToBottom =
|
|
viewport.scrollHeight - viewport.scrollTop - viewport.clientHeight
|
|
|
|
return distanceToBottom <= AUTO_SCROLL_THRESHOLD_PX
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
type LogsPanelProps = {
|
|
logs: string[]
|
|
wrapColumns: number
|
|
contentRef: RefObject<HTMLDivElement | null>
|
|
measureRef: RefObject<HTMLSpanElement | null>
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
export function LogsPanel({
|
|
logs,
|
|
wrapColumns,
|
|
contentRef,
|
|
measureRef,
|
|
}: LogsPanelProps) {
|
|
const { t } = useTranslation()
|
|
const scrollAreaRef = useRef<HTMLDivElement>(null)
|
|
const viewportRef = useRef<HTMLDivElement | null>(null)
|
|
const shouldStickToBottomRef = useRef(true)
|
|
|
|
useEffect(() => {
|
|
const scrollArea = scrollAreaRef.current
|
|
const viewport = scrollArea?.querySelector<HTMLDivElement>(
|
|
'[data-slot="scroll-area-viewport"]',
|
|
)
|
|
|
|
if (!viewport) {
|
|
return
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
viewportRef.current = viewport
|
|
|
|
const updateStickToBottom = () => {
|
|
shouldStickToBottomRef.current = isNearBottom(viewport)
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
updateStickToBottom()
|
|
viewport.addEventListener("scroll", updateStickToBottom)
|
|
|
|
return () => {
|
|
viewport.removeEventListener("scroll", updateStickToBottom)
|
|
if (viewportRef.current === viewport) {
|
|
viewportRef.current = null
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
}, [])
|
|
|
|
useEffect(() => {
|
|
const viewport = viewportRef.current
|
|
if (!viewport) {
|
|
return
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
// Clearing logs or switching runs can replace the buffer with much shorter
|
|
// content, so a previously stale "not sticky" state needs to be rechecked.
|
|
if (!shouldStickToBottomRef.current) {
|
|
shouldStickToBottomRef.current = isNearBottom(viewport)
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
if (shouldStickToBottomRef.current) {
|
|
viewport.scrollTop = viewport.scrollHeight
|
|
}
|
|
}, [logs])
